I am working on a prototype application that has a main menu with
cascaded sub-menus and commands. I'd like that even handlers be called
whenever the user sweeps the mouse cursor over a menu item or clicks
any menu item (command or not).

I have assigned functions as 'command' or 'postcommand' options of my
menu objects, but this does not give the intended effect.

I have tried to bind different events (<Enter> / <Activate> /
<FocusIn>...) to these, but none seems to work (even after setting
'takefocus' to true).

Can anyone help ?
